When I play chess I often try to improve my game by analyzing the moves afterwards. Often when the computer sees a "blunder" or "missed opportunity" it's by looking 10+ moves ahead. At my current level this is like telling me that I could jump higher if I lived on the moon... There is just no way I can foresee the game 10 moves ahead.
Is there anyway to tell the computer to look fewer steps ahead?
The lowest possible depth is 14 ply, or 7 moves, in the Analysis settings.
